Baby Boomers Tell Their Kids To Fly The Coop And Keep The Nest Empty
Helen Morris
www.canada.com

Overview: “Baby boomers are keen to stay in their own community and even their existing home when they retire but they don't want their adult children to live with them, according to RBC's homeownership survey released Tuesday.”

Boom Goes The Ego
Kevin Kusinitz
www.weeklystandard.com

Overview: “If the Americans who lived through the Depression and won the Second World War were the Greatest Generation, then the Baby Boomers would have to be the Greatest Ego Generation. Pampered like no others before them, free to explore their own interests while their parents worked hard to put food on the table, the Boomers eventually pursued pop culture as their time killer of choice.”

'Helicopter' Parents Just Have To Hover When They Send Kids Off To College
M.S. Enkoki
www.ohio.com

Overview: “Loosely defined, helicopter parents are the baby boomer moms and dads who virtually accompany their offspring to campus, monitoring and intervening, fussing and fretting.”
